Édouard Richard (20th century) – Still life with poppies – Oil on panel
Édouard Richard
A French painter of the twentieth century, known for his floral still lifes and decorative compositions in bright colors, in a post-Impressionist vein.
Beautiful oil on panel depicting a still life with poppies, executed with a generous and expressive brushwork.
The warm palette, dominated by reds and oranges, is balanced by a light background and a vase rendered with transparency and subtlety.
The composition is animated by the presence of fallen flowers in the foreground, adding depth and dynamism to the whole.
A high-quality decorative piece, typical of mid-20th-century French production.
Signed 'Edouard Richard' at the bottom left.
Metal nameplate bearing "Edouard RICHARD" on the frame.
Oil on panel (wood panel)
Work with visible impasto.
Dimensions
Sight size: 40 × 48 cm
With frame: 52 × 60 cm
Very good overall condition
Normal wear and patina related to aging
Old gilded moulded wooden frame, with signs of wear (see photos)
Old backing with a nailed frame and period hanging wire.
